openMyAdmin is a free CMS, established on the basis of recent trends in developing web applications such as AJAX, MVC and OOP. Basic principles of CMS: web desktop and modular structure.

Features

  • Webdesktop: now you can simultaneously perform more tasks in a single browser window.
